Role:EnsembleGenre:ConcertoOrchestralSymphonyThe Berlin Philharmonic Brass Ensemble is a world-renowned classical music ensemble that has been captivating audiences with their exceptional performances for over 30 years. The ensemble was founded in 1985 by members of the Berlin Philharmonic Orchestra, one of the most prestigious orchestras in the world. The founding members of the Berlin Philharmonic Brass Ensemble were Klaus Wallendorf (horn), Fergus McWilliam (trombone), Henning Trog (tuba), and Stefan Dohr (horn). These four musicians had a shared passion for brass music and wanted to create an ensemble that would showcase the unique sound and versatility of brass instruments. Since its founding, the Berlin Philharmonic Brass Ensemble has expanded to include additional members, including trombonist Olaf Ott and trumpeters Gábor Tarkövi and Tamás Velenczei. The ensemble's current lineup consists of eight members, all of whom are members of the Berlin Philharmonic Orchestra. The Berlin Philharmonic Brass Ensemble has performed at some of the most prestigious venues in the world, including Carnegie Hall in New York, the Royal Albert Hall in London, and the Berlin Philharmonic Hall. They have also performed at numerous music festivals, including the Salzburg Festival, the Lucerne Festival, and the BBC Proms. One of the highlights of the Berlin Philharmonic Brass Ensemble's career was their performance at the 2006 FIFA World Cup Final in Berlin. The ensemble performed the German national anthem before the match, which was watched by millions of people around the world. The Berlin Philharmonic Brass Ensemble has also received numerous awards and accolades for their exceptional performances. In 1992, they were awarded the Echo Klassik award for their album "Brass in Berlin." They have also been nominated for Grammy Awards for their recordings of works by Bach and Gabrieli. The ensemble's repertoire includes a wide range of music, from classical works by Bach and Mozart to contemporary pieces by composers such as John Williams and Ennio Morricone. They are known for their exceptional musicianship and their ability to bring a unique sound and energy to every performance. In addition to their performances, the Berlin Philharmonic Brass Ensemble is also committed to music education and outreach. They regularly hold masterclasses and workshops for young musicians, and they have worked with schools and community organizations to promote the importance of music education. Overall, the Berlin Philharmonic Brass Ensemble is a world-class ensemble that has made a significant impact on the world of classical music. Their exceptional musicianship, versatility, and commitment to music education have made them one of the most respected and beloved brass ensembles in the world.More....
